Transfer Ticket Issued
 
Observed 1744 on a 235.

I had been on a walk along the Grand Union canal (on topic in this NG
!) and had taken a 235 to where it started near Brentford Magistartes
Court. After Windmill Bridge/Three Bridges and a bar lunch at the
Plough, Norwood Green (recommended) we returned by Osterly Park and I
got a H28 (Tfl bus with only one door) from Tesco to where it
intersected the route of the 235.

I was intending to go all the way to Sunbury Village but it terminated
short at Sunbury Cross after a unexpected diversion, complete with
display "this bus is on divirsion, please listen for announcements"
which caused us to pass the BP Research Centre.

I had a National concession bus pass, so didn't care, but a young chap
who had paid the cash fare demanded something to avoid paying again and
got it. I congratulated him, left him to wait for the next 235, and
walked round the corner into Staines Road West to wait for the 555 at
its Sunbury Cross stop.
